One of the first things you will notice when researching car rental software pricing is that there are several different pricing models available. Some companies offer a one-time fee for their software, while others charge a monthly subscription fee. There are also companies that offer a pay-as-you-go pricing model, where you only pay for the features you use. Each pricing model has its pros and cons, so it’s important to carefully consider your company’s needs and budget before making a decision.
When it comes to one-time fees, the cost can vary widely depending on the features included in the software. Some companies offer basic packages for a few hundred dollars, while others charge thousands of dollars for more advanced features. While a one-time fee may seem like a more cost-effective option upfront, it’s important to consider the long-term costs of maintaining and updating the software. If you choose a one-time fee model, make sure to factor in any additional costs for maintenance and support in the future.
Monthly subscription fees are another common pricing model for car rental software. With a monthly subscription, you pay a fixed amount each month to access the software and its features. This pricing model can be more budget-friendly for smaller companies, as it allows you to spread out the cost of the software over time. However, it’s important to consider whether the monthly fee fits into your company’s budget and whether you will be able to afford it in the long run.
Pay-as-you-go pricing is a more flexible option for companies that want to pay for only the features they use. With this pricing model, you are charged based on the volume of transactions or the number of users using the software. This can be a cost-effective option for companies with fluctuating rental volumes, as you only pay for what you use. However, pay-as-you-go pricing can be unpredictable, as your costs will vary depending on your usage. It’s important to carefully track your usage and budget accordingly to avoid unexpected costs.
In addition to the pricing model, there are other factors that can influence car rental software pricing. The size of your company, the number of users, and the level of support you require can all impact the cost of the software. Larger companies with more users and complex needs will typically pay more for software with advanced features and support. Smaller companies may be able to get by with a basic package at a lower cost. It’s important to consider your company’s specific needs and choose a software package that aligns with your budget and goals.
When comparing car rental software pricing, it’s important to look beyond the upfront cost and consider the value that the software will bring to your business. Consider the features included in each package, as well as the level of support and training provided by the company. Look for software that is user-friendly and intuitive, so your staff can quickly adapt to using it. Consider whether the software integrates with other systems you use, such as accounting or CRM software, to streamline your operations.
